MAORI GATHERING.
TO EE HELD AT FOXTON. (By Telegraph—Press Association.) FOXTON, This Day. A big native gathering will be held at the Motuiti pah during Christmas. A memorial to the late Rev. T. Paerata will be unveiled by Sir Maui Pomare and Sir A. T. Ngata and a confirmation service held by Bishop Sprott. Matters concerning the welfare of the native race will be discussed, and there will be an entertainment by the natives, including old-time dances and hakas. Representative natives from all parts of the North Island are already assembling.
